Seoul shares end above 6,000 for first time since U.S.-Iran conflict

Rapporteret af AI Billede genereret af AI

Seoul shares soared more than 2 percent on April 15 to close above 6,000 for the first time since the U.S.-Iran conflict erupted in late February. The Korean won strengthened against the U.S. dollar. Hopes for U.S.-Iran peace talks and Wall Street gains drove the rally.
